Flooded basement cleanup services involve the removal of excess water from a property's lower levels following flooding events. These services typically include water extraction, drying, and dehumidification to prevent further damage and mold growth. Professionals utilize specialized equipment to thoroughly remove standing water and moisture from walls, floors, and other affected surfaces. Once the initial cleanup is complete, additional steps such as sanitizing and deodorizing may be performed to restore the space to a safe and habitable condition.
This service addresses common problems associated with basement flooding, including structural damage, mold development, and property deterioration. Standing water can weaken foundations and cause warping or cracking in walls and flooring. Excess moisture creates an environment conducive to mold and bacterial growth, which can pose health risks to occupants. Flooded basement cleanup helps mitigate these issues by effectively removing water and controlling moisture levels, thereby protecting the property's integrity and the health of its residents.

Assessment and Inspection Costs - The cost for evaluating a flooded basement typically 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the size and severity of the water damage. An inspection may include identifying water sources and assessing structural impact. These fees are generally separate from cleanup services.
Water Extraction Expenses - Removing standing water from a basement can cost between $1,000 and $3,500, with larger or heavily flooded areas incurring higher charges. The price often depends on the volume of water and the equipment used by local service providers.
Cleaning and Disinfection Fees - Professional cleaning and disinfecting services usually fall within the $500 to $2,000 range. Costs are influenced by the extent of contamination and the level of sanitation required to restore the space.
Drying and Restoration Costs - Complete drying and restoration services typically cost between $2,000 and $6,000, depending on the size of the basement and the extent of structural repairs needed. Additional services like mold remediation may increase the overall cost.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the common causes of basement flooding? Basement flooding can result from heavy rains, burst pipes, sewer backups, or poor drainage around the property.
How do professionals typically remove flood water from a basement? Service providers use pumps, wet vacuums, and specialized drying equipment to extract water and begin the drying process.
What steps are involved in cleaning a flooded basement? Cleanup generally includes water removal, debris clearance, drying, mold prevention, and sanitization of affected areas.
Is mold growth a concern after a basement flood? Yes, mold can develop if moisture is not properly dried and treated, making professional cleanup important.
